Bollywood Greek God Hrithik Roshan, who is busy promoting Mohenjo Daro, has opened up about the film fraternity supporting Akshay Kumar-starrer-Rustom over his upcoming historical drama.

On being asked about the same, Hrithik, 42, was quoted by PinkVilla as saying, “It is a good thing. It’s a fraternity. If someone needs support then we must support.”
A host of celebrities, including Salman Khan, Ranveer Singh and Sonam Kapoor, have extended their support to ‘Rustom’.

Releasing on August 12, both films deal with different subject as Rustom also starring Ileana D’Cruz is based on an infamous case involving a Navy officer, while Mohenjo Daro, starring debutant Pooja Hegde, is set in 2016 BC in the ancient city of Mohenjo-daro in the era of the Indus Valley civilization.
